Adūr, a municipality in Kerala's Pathanamthitta district, is a hub of cultural heritage and traditional Indian charm. As the headquarters of the Adoor Taluk and Revenue Division, it is strategically located 18 km from Pathanamthitta and 90 km from Thiruvananthapuram. With a population of around 29,171 as per the 2011 Census, Adūr offers a tranquil escape for those looking to explore the rich cultural tapestry of Kerala. Public transport is available, but renting a vehicle can offer more flexibility to explore nearby areas.
Try local Kerala delicacies available in small eateries around the city.
Respect local customs and dress modestly, especially when visiting temples.
Carry an umbrella during the monsoon season as the region experiences heavy rainfall.
Spring is a pleasant time to visit with mild weather, ideal for exploring the city and its surroundings.
Summers can be hot and humid; stay hydrated and plan indoor activities during peak heat.
Fall offers a comfortable climate, making it a great time for outdoor exploration.
Winters are mild, perfect for enjoying the city's cultural sites without the crowds.
